AmarokTimer is an Amarok script that allows users to control playlists with the timed events.
Usage:
Write command to AmarokTimers search box and then drag created item from the AmarokTimer to the playlist. Rule is targeted to the next playlist row.
Syntax: HHMM title;parameter=value
HH = hours
MM = minutes
SS = seconds
duration=MMSS; length of the clip (optional)
end=HHMM; end time of the clip (optional)
time=HHMM; time when the next row is triggered in the playlist.
Examples:
Play next track to the rule at 12:00 and if it still plays at 12:15 then move to the next track.
1200 News 12; end=1215
Known bugs:
- Amarok crashes sometimes when playing is stopped.
- Using timing in playlist (or more probably anywhere in qtscript) to control playing breaks stop- and/or pause buttons.
